Workplace exposure - Assessment of sampler performance for measurement of airborne particle concentrations - Part 6: Transport and handling tests
This European Standard specifies a performance test of loaded collection substrates for samplers for the inhalable, thoracic or respirable aerosol fractions and, as alternative, a handling test, both for testing transport losses of aerosol sampler substrates under prescribed conditions in order to calculate the expanded uncertainty of a measuring procedure according to EN 13205 1:2012, Annex A . The transport test involves shipping loaded substrates with ordinary mail, whereas the handling test uses a shaker.
This part of EN 13205 applies to all samplers used for the health-related sampling of particles in workplace air.

Overview - EN 13205-6:2014 (Transport & handling tests for aerosol samplers)
EN 13205-6:2014, published by CEN, is part of the EN 13205 series for workplace exposure assessment. This part specifies performance tests to quantify transport and handling losses from loaded collection substrates used with samplers for the inhalable, thoracic and respirable aerosol fractions. Two complementary methods are defined: a transport test (shipping loaded substrates by ordinary mail) and a handling test (exposing loaded substrates to vibration using a shaker). Results are used to calculate the expanded uncertainty of a measuring procedure in accordance with EN 13205-1:2014, Annex A.
Key topics and technical requirements
- Scope: applies to all samplers used for health-related sampling of particles in workplace air (inhalable, thoracic, respirable fractions).
- Two test methods:
- Transport test - loading substrates with aerosol, shipping via ordinary mail, and weighing before/after to determine mass loss.
- Handling test - loading substrates with a specified aerosol and exposing them to controlled vibration (shaker) to simulate handling losses.
- Measurement and calculation:
- Determination of mass losses, standard deviations and average relative losses for subsets of samples.
- Use of test data to estimate random and non‑random measurement errors due to transport/handling and to calculate the expanded uncertainty contribution.
- Test reporting: requires documented test laboratory details, sampler and substrate description, test equipment, procedures, results and summary (as specified in clauses for transport and handling tests).
- Terminology and symbols align with EN 1540, EN 13205‑1 and EN 13205‑2; uncertainty control references include ISO 15767.

1) The inhalable convention is undefined for particle sizes in excess of 100 µm or for wind speeds greater than 4 m/s. The tests required to assess performance are therefore limited to these conditions. Should such large particle sizes or wind speeds actually exist at the time of sampling, it is possible that different samplers meeting this standard give different results. SIST EN 13205-6:2014
